NVIDIA RTX 2000 Ada Generation vs NVIDIA Quadro FX 3450

We compared two Desktop platform GPUs: 16GB VRAM RTX 2000 Ada Generation and 256MB VRAM Quadro FX 3450 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

NVIDIA RTX 2000 Ada Generation 's Advantages
Released 18 years and 7 months late
Boost Clock2130MHz
Larger VRAM bandwidth (256.0GB/s vs 32.00GB/s)
2816 additional rendering cores
Lower TDP (70W vs 83W)
